I ordered a hard tri-fold tonneau cover with the build for $1180.00. When I was browsing the dealership accessory shop the same cover was going for $2,300.
Hmmm.... I have no idea what product you're looking at exactly.

I purchased the soft tonneau cover in the attached link from my dealer for 2022 Mav for $569 installed.

Maverick 2022 Advantage Soft Folding Tonneau Bed Cover ~ VNZ6Z99501A42A (ford.com)

It's currently listed at $599 on the web site plus $72 for installation = $671

The same soft tonneau is listed as an option on the 2023 Build and Price web site for $590.

The same accessory web site has the following hard tri-fold tonneau cover:

Maverick 2022 REV Hard Folding In Rail Tonneau Bed Cover ~ VNZ6Z99501A42C (ford.com)

Price is listed as $1299 + $120 installation = $1419

I see the hard tri-fold cover on the Build and Price web site for $1180 as you stated.

I should point out that I bought my 2022 Maverick as is off a dealer lot when the original customer declined the order. When I was ordering my 2023, I didn't order Spray-in Bedliner, mudflaps, etc. with the order because I don't want to potentially delay its delivery, even it means paying a bit more after it gets here.
